Express Negligence & Release Statement

Texas law requires that any waiver of liability for negligence be stated expressly and conspicuously. The following statement satisfies that requirement:

By participating in any 4KBJJ activity, you expressly release, discharge, and waive all claims against 4 Korners Jiu-Jitsu and Ashon LLC — including claims arising from the negligence of 4 Korners Jiu-Jitsu, Ashon LLC, their owners, officers, instructors, employees, contractors, and agents — for any injury, loss, or damage to your person or property, whether foreseeable or not.

This release of negligence is a material term of this Agreement. If you do not accept it, do not participate in any 4KBJJ program or activity.

Assumption of Risk

Brazilian Jiu-Jitsu, boxing, and martial arts training involve physical contact and inherent risk of injury. Risks include, but are not limited to: bruises, strains, sprains, dislocations, fractures, torn muscles or ligaments, concussion, nerve damage, and in extreme cases, paralysis or death. These risks exist even when all participants and instructors exercise reasonable care.

These injuries may result from your own actions, the actions or inactions of other students, or the actions or inactions of instructors.

By participating in any class, free trial, seminar, camp, or event offered by 4KBJJ, you voluntarily and knowingly assume all risks associated with martial arts training — including all injuries, costs, and damages that may result, whether caused in whole or in part by yourself, other students, instructors, or 4KBJJ staff.

Minors & Parental Consent

Important — Texas Law on Minor Waivers

Under Texas law, a parent or guardian may not waive a minor child's own personal injury claims (such as pain and suffering). This Agreement waives the parent's or guardian's own economic claims (such as medical expenses) to the fullest extent permitted by law. The minor's personal injury claims are not waived by this Agreement.

If you are enrolling a minor (any person under 18 years of age), by booking or bringing that minor to any 4KBJJ activity you confirm that:

  1. You are the minor's parent or legal guardian with full legal authority to act on their behalf;
  2. You have read and agree to all terms of this Agreement on the minor's behalf;
  3. You accept all obligations described in this Agreement, including the assumption of risk, indemnification, and release of your own claims; and
  4. You understand that this Agreement binds you, your heirs, assigns, executors, and administrators with respect to your own claims, but does not extinguish the minor's independent personal injury claims under Texas law.
